On October 4, 2021, at Grace Villa in Hamilton with his stepdaughter Yvonne Beaudet on his port side and his niece, Victoria Randall on his starboard side, Glenn Freeman, 72, set sail for high seas in heaven with his wife Frances at the helm.
Predeceased by his wife Frances and his parents Lennard and Evelyn, Glenn leaves behind his stepdaughter Yvonne Beaudet and grandson, Jamie Daughtrey (Kaitlin) and great grandchildren, Bentley, Sadie and Willow; sister Gayle Hagerman (née Freeman), (Bob), and nieces Victoria Randall (Martin Savard) and Kae Randall Blancher (Joshua Blancher) and nephew Andrew Bebee (Christina). Also survived by great nieces and nephews, William, Charlotte, Caroline, Georgina, Sebastian, Lillie, Kate, Lu and Lilith.
Glenn was a long-time member of the Hamilton Jaycees and was awarded the highest international honour in the organization as Senator. He was also a long-time member of the Bronte Harbour Yacht Club. After many years in pharmaceutical sales, Glenn mastered the art of creating 6-foot subs as a Mr. Sub franchisee and went on to become a respected and cherished bus driver for handicapped children. He will be missed. Cremation has taken place and a private family service and interment will be held.
